Black Mold Removal Strategies

Safe and effective black mold removal necessitates the expertise of trained professionals. They possess the knowledge, experience, and specialized equipment to handle mold infestations safely and efficiently.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of the professional black mold removal process:

Inspection and Assessment

The first step involves a thorough inspection of the affected property to determine the presence, type, and extent of mold growth. Professionals use specialized tools, such as mo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ras, to identify hidden mold growth and assess the moisture levels that contribute to its proliferation. This assessment helps determine the appropriate removal strategy and the extent of remediation required.

Containment and Isolation

Once the inspection is complete, the mold-affected area is contained to prevent the spread of spores during the removal process. This typically involves sealing off the area with plastic sheeting and using negative air pressure to create a controlled environment. Negative air pressure ensures that mold spores are contained within the work area and are not released into other parts of the property.

Physical Removal

The next step involves the physical removal of mold colonies from affected surfaces. This is typically done using a combination of manual and mechanical methods. Professionals use specialized HEPA (High-Efficiency Particulate Air) vacuums to remove mold spores from surfaces and from the air. Other methods include wire brushing, sanding, and soda blasting, depending on the severity of the infestation and the type of surface affected.

Chemical Treatment

After the physical removal of mold, professionals apply anti-fungal and antimicrobial agents to kill any remaining spores and prevent regrowth. These chemicals are carefully selected based on the type of mold present and the surface being treated. It’s crucial to use EPA-registered products and to foll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ully to ensure safety and effectiveness.

Moisture Control

Addressing the underlying moisture issues that caused the mold growth is essential to prevent its recurrence. This may involve repairing leaks, improving ventilation, or installing dehumidifiers. Professionals will identify the source of moisture and recommend the most effective solutions to maintain a dry environment and prevent future mold problems.

Post-Removal Verification

Once the mold removal process is complete, professionals conduct a post-remediation verification to ensure the effectiveness of the treatment. This may involve visual inspection, air sampling, and surface testing to confirm that mold spores have been successfully removed and that the area is safe for occupancy. This step provides peace of mind to homeowners, knowing that the mold problem has been effectively addressed.

Prevention

Preventing black mold growth is the most effective way to protect your home and health. By controlling moisture levels, promoting ventilation, and maintaining a clean environment, you can significantly reduce the risk of black mold infestations. Here are some essential preventive measures:

  1. Control Humidity Levels: Black mold thrives in humid environments. Maintaining relative humidity levels below 50% creates an unfavorable environment for mold growth. Use dehumidifiers, especially during humid months, to regulate indoor humidity. Ensure proper ventilation when using showers, baths, and cooking appliances to prevent moisture buildup.
  2. Ventilate Adequately: Proper ventilation is crucial for removing excess moisture and preventing mold growth. Open windows and doors regularly to allow fresh air to circulate. Use exhaust fans in bathrooms and kitchens to vent moisture-laden air outdoors. Ensure that crawl spaces and attics are adequately ventilated to prevent condensation and moisture buildup.
  3. Fix Water Leaks Promptly: Water leaks are a primary source of moisture that can lead to black mold growth. Inspect your plumbing system, roof, and foundation regularly for leaks. Repair any leaks promptly to prevent water damage and create a dry environment. Address plumbing issues, such as dripping faucets and running toilets, immediately to minimize moisture sources.
  4. Clean and Disinfect Regularly: Black mold feeds on organic matter, such as soap scum, dirt, and dust. Regularly clean and disinfect bathrooms and kitchens, paying close attention to areas prone to moisture, such as shower stalls, sinks, and countertops. Use mold-inhibiting cleaners or a bleach solution to kill mold spores and prevent their growth.

Detection

Early detection of black mold is crucial for preventing its spread and minimizing potential health risks. Familiarize yourself with the common signs of black mold to address the problem promptly. Here are some telltale indicators of black mold growth:

  1. Visible Mold Growth: Black mold often appears as dark, slimy patches on walls, ceilings, floors, and other surfaces. The texture may vary from powdery to fuzzy, depending on the type of surface and the extent of growth. However, it’s important to note that not all black-colored mold is Stachybotrys chartarum. Other types of mold can also appear black.
  2. Musty Odor: Black mold emits a distinct musty, earthy odor that is often described as smelling like wet soil or rotting wood. This odor is a strong indicator of mold growth, even if visible signs are not present.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ate further.
  3. Respiratory Symptoms: Exposure to black mold can trigger various respiratory symptoms, such as coughing, wheezing, shortness of breath, nasal congestion, and sore throat. If you or your family members experience these symptoms, especially after spending time in a specific area of your home, black mold could be the culprit.
  4. Allergic Reactions: Black mold spores can trigger allergic reactions in sensitive individuals. Symptoms may include sneezing, runny nose, itchy eyes, skin rashes, and headaches. If you notice these symptoms, especially in conjunction with other signs of black mold, it’s crucial to address the issue promptly.

Causes of Black Mold Growth

Black mold requires moisture, warmth, and a food source to grow and proliferate. Understanding the common causes of black mold growth can help homeowners take preventive measures and address potential problems promptly.

  1. Excessive Moisture: Moisture is the primary culprit behind black mold growth. Water leaks, flooding, high humidity, and condensation create ideal conditions for mold spores to thrive. Leaky roofs, plumbing issues, and inadequate ventilation are common sources of excess moisture in homes.
  2. Poor Ventilation: Inadequate ventilation traps moisture inside homes, creating a breeding ground for mold. Bathrooms, kitchens, laundry rooms, and basements are particularly susceptible to mold growth due to high moisture levels and limited ventilation. Proper ventilation, such as exhaust fans and open windows, helps remove excess moisture and reduce the risk of mold.
  3. Organic Materials: Black mold feeds on organic materials, such as wood, paper, drywall, and fabrics. These materials provide the necessary nutrients for mold spores to germinate and grow. Homes with cellulose-based insulation, wood framing, and drywall are particularly vulnerable to black mold infestations.

Signs of Black Mold

Early detection of black mold is essential for preventing its spread and minimizing potential health risks. Recognizing the telltale signs of black mold can help homeowners address the problem promptly and seek professional help when necessary. Here are some common indicators of black mold growth:

* Musty Odor: One of the most noticeable signs of black mold is a persistent musty odor, often described as smelling like wet soil, mildew, or rotting wood. This distinctive odor is a strong indicator of mold growth, even if visible signs are not yet apparent. If you notice a musty smell in your home, especially in areas prone to moisture, it’s essential to investigate further.

* Dark, Fuzzy Patches: Black mold typically appears as dark, slimy patches on various surfaces, including walls, ceilings, floors, grout, and even furniture. The color can range from black to dark green, and the texture may vary from powdery to fuzzy, depending on the type of surface and the extent of growth. However, it’s important to note that not all black-colored mold is Stachybotrys chartarum. Other types of mold can also appear black.

* Health Issues: Exposure to black mold can trigger various health problems, ranging from mild allergic reactions to severe respiratory issues. If you or your family members experience unexplained respiratory problems, such as coughing, wheezing, shortness of breath, nasal congestion, or sore throat, especially after spending time in a specific area of your home, black mold could be the culprit.

* Moisture Damage: Black mold thrives in damp and humid environments, so areas with water damage or high humidity are prime breeding grounds for mold growth. If you notice water stains, peeling paint, warped walls, or a damp feeling in certain areas of your home, it’s essential to check for mold growth, as these are signs of moisture problems that can foster mold proliferation.
